Sculpture, Kasimiye Medrese, Mardin, Turkey
Relief above the medicine classroom door, in the Kasimiye Medrese, a madrasa built 1407-45 in Artuqid style under sultans Isa Bey and Kasim, south facade, in Mardin, Artuklu, Turkey. The building features an ornamental portal known as the Crown Gate, masjid or mosque, and a cloistered courtyard with pool. Picture by Manuel Cohen
